The correct answer is Autophonic (Ghan).

  • ​'Ramjhol' is an autotrophic (Ghan) type of folk Musical instrument.
  • The Bhopas of Bherunji wear large ghungroos around their waists and sway their bodies to provide a rhythm.
  • The war dance of the Godwad area, the Ramjhol, is performed to the rhythm of the large ankle bells.
  • Autophonic Ghan musical instrument has four types which are given as follows- 
Type Instruments
Tinkler Tankora, Jhalar, Ghanta, Veer Ghanta, Shri Mandal, Tokriyo.
Clapper Jhanjh, Tal, Manjira, Thali.
Jingler Ghungroo, Khartal, Ramjhol, Lezim.
 Knocking  Dandiya, Khartal, Matka.
Scrapper Kagrachh.
